声振论坛

 找回密码
 我要加入

QQ登录

只需一步,快速开始

查看: 1544|回复: 4

[综合讨论] 哪一种函数在求解含矩阵的2次微分方程中应用的比较广?

[复制链接]
发表于 2007-12-2 09:29 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有账号?我要加入

x
我现在求解的一个一元2次的微分方程的系数都是矩阵,为了就是求出结构的x'和x,但现在感觉在执行的时候总是出错,报错也很奇怪,我想问问各位高手,哪个函数在求解含矩阵的微分方程上应用的比较好的

[ 本帖最后由 eight 于 2007-12-2 10:45 编辑 ]
回复
分享到:

使用道具 举报

发表于 2007-12-2 10:09 | 显示全部楼层
报错大多是因为用法不对,对解微分方程了解不多。

好像dsolve是支持向量形式调用的,具体看下帮助文档吧
 楼主| 发表于 2007-12-2 18:52 | 显示全部楼层

微分方程的具体形式

我的微分方程是这样的,KX+MX''+CX'=F,根据微分方程的求解方法应该是写成这样的形式:Xdot=[x(2);1/M*(F-CX(2)'-KX(1))],但如果现在K,M,C是10*10的矩阵,F为一个10*1的数列,具体的xdot的表达式又是什么样子,现在我也只能这样的一点一点的请教了
发表于 2007-12-2 19:06 | 显示全部楼层
>> dsolve('M*D2y+C*Dy+K*y = F', 'y(0) = 1, Dy(pi/a) = 0')

ans =太长略了

并不懂这个,但是应该可以解决你的问题

如果是系数是矩阵,那么解就是一个矩阵方程。

完全是对help例子的照葫芦画瓢,如果你有疑问建议仔细阅读help文档
发表于 2009-4-25 09:48 | 显示全部楼层

回复 地板 花如月 的帖子

花如月:
    你好!dsolve得到的是函数的表达式,如何求得它的数值解呢?
您需要登录后才可以回帖 登录 | 我要加入

本版积分规则

QQ|小黑屋|Archiver|手机版|联系我们|声振论坛

GMT+8, 2024-11-6 07:15 , Processed in 0.072856 second(s), 18 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表